“Tabitha?” Richard asked over the phone, his eyebrows furrowing at the mention of her name.
“Yes,” Adriana answered, her voice sounding low, as if she feared what she was about to say.
“What should I know about Tabitha?” Richard asked.
“She is….” Adriana’s words hung in her mouth the moment she remembered what kind of monster Tabitha was.
“Adriana?” Richard called her name, checking if she was still on the line.
Adriana swallowed again, her hands shaking from nervousness.
“Well, I… I… I just wanted to ask how she is,” Adriana said, biting her lips afterward, unable to spill the beans.
“You already told me she tricked me into believing she was suffering from amnesia, and you dare to call me just to ask about her?” Richard asked, sounding angry.
“I just…”
“Keep your words to yourself, Adriana.”
“Richard, please, I…”
Richard hung up before she could express what she had to say.
Adriana ran her hands through her hair in frustration.
“Why couldn’t you do it, Adriana? You should’ve tried to help the man you claim to love.” Adriana bit her lower lip hard and sat on the bed.
“Tabitha isn’t human,” Adriana muttered to herself as her mind flashed back to twenty years ago, the day she was kidnapped by Tabitha, also known as Paulina.

**FLASHBACK, TWENTY YEARS AGO**
Little Adriana held Julio’s hand with a smile on her face as they walked around the mall. She had a bow tie ribbon on her head, and she looked extremely cute in her elegant Snow White dress.
“Daddy, are you also going to get me the toys you promised?” her smiling voice asked.
“Of course I will, Adriana. Daddy always keeps his promises,” Julio replied, and she grinned.
Julio got a call and answered it. He began talking to his business partner on the phone while he walked inside the mall with Adriana, who was still holding his hand.
She then saw a group of teenagers dancing. She had always been a fan of hip hop music and dance, so she let go of Julio’s hand to watch the teenagers dance.
Engrossed in the call, Julio was unaware that Adriana was no longer holding his hand and continued walking.
Adriana kept grinning and clapping her hands as she was entertained by the teenagers who were dancing.
When the dance ended, she turned around but couldn’t find Julio.
“Daddy?” Adriana muttered, looking around for Julio until she bumped into Tabitha, who had a huge hat covering her head, along with dark gloves and shades.
She took off the shades and beamed a nice smile at Adriana.
“Are you looking for your daddy?” she asked, and Adriana nodded, her eyes welling with tears.
“I’m going to take you to your daddy. He left because he had something to do.”
“Are you sure?” Adriana asked.
“I’m sure of it, Adriana,” Tabitha said, giving a warm smile that made Adriana believe her.
“Take me to my daddy,” she said.
Tabitha held her little hand, and before leaving, she handed an envelope to a man.
“Make sure they don’t see me leaving with her on the CCTV cameras,” she whispered into the man’s ear, and the man nodded.
“Let’s go, Adriana.” She smiled warmly at her again. Thinking she was nice, Adriana smiled back.
Adriana only realized she was not nice when she was brought to the underground bunker.
“This isn’t my house. You said you’d bring me home!”
